web前端开发工程师如何学习

web前端开发工程师如何学习

Web前端开发工程师可以通过学习HTML、CSS、JavaScript、框架与库、工具与环境、项目实战、社区与资源、持续学习来提升自己的技能。 学习HTML和CSS是前端开发的基础,它们决定了网页的结构和样式;JavaScript则是前端开发的核心,使网页具有交互性;框架与库如React、Vue、Angular等可以提高开发效率;工具与环境包括开发工具、版本控制、自动化工具等;通过项目实战可以将理论知识应用到实际项目中;参与社区与资源的分享可以获得更多的学习资源和支持;持续学习保持技术的更新与提升。HTML是前端开发的基础语言,它决定了网页的基本结构和内容表示。学习HTML时需要掌握常见的标签、元素属性、语义化标签等。

一、HTML与CSS

HTML和CSS是前端开发的基石。HTML(超文本标记语言)用于定义网页的结构和内容,CSS(层叠样式表)用于定义网页的样式和布局。学习HTML时,需要掌握基本标签如<div><span><a><img>等,以及语义化标签如<header><footer><article>等。CSS则需要掌握选择器、属性、盒模型、布局模型(如Flexbox和Grid)等。通过结合HTML和CSS,可以制作出静态但美观的网页。

二、JavaScript

JavaScript是前端开发的核心语言,它使网页具有动态交互功能。学习JavaScript时,需要掌握变量、数据类型、运算符、控制结构(如条件语句和循环)、函数、对象、数组等基础知识。深入学习时,还需了解原型链、作用域、闭包、异步编程(如Promise、async/await)等高级概念。通过JavaScript可以实现用户交互、数据处理、AJAX请求等功能,使网页更加生动和用户友好。

三、框架与库

框架与库可以极大地提高开发效率。常见的前端框架和库有React、Vue、Angular等。React是由Facebook开发的一个用于构建用户界面的JavaScript库,特点是组件化和虚拟DOM。Vue是一个渐进式框架,易于上手且灵活性高。Angular是由Google开发的一个完整的前端框架,适用于大型应用开发。学习这些框架和库可以帮助开发者快速构建复杂的前端应用。

四、工具与环境

前端开发中使用的工具和环境也非常重要。常用的开发工具有VS Code、WebStorm等。版本控制工具如Git可以帮助管理代码版本,常用的平台有GitHub、GitLab等。构建工具如Webpack、Parcel可以优化代码、提高加载速度。自动化工具如Gulp、Grunt可以简化开发流程、提高效率。通过熟练掌握这些工具和环境,可以极大地提高开发效率和代码质量。

五、项目实战

通过项目实战可以将理论知识应用到实际项目中,从而巩固所学知识。可以从简单的项目开始,如个人博客、待办事项清单等,逐步挑战更复杂的项目,如电商网站、社交平台等。在项目实战中,可以学到项目规划、代码组织、团队协作等实际开发技能。同时,通过不断实践,可以发现并解决实际开发中的问题,提升问题解决能力和代码质量。

六、社区与资源

参与社区与资源的分享可以获得更多的学习资源和支持。常见的前端开发社区有Stack Overflow、GitHub、Reddit等,通过参与社区讨论、提问和回答问题,可以获得他人的经验和建议。同时,可以关注一些优质的博客和技术网站,如MDN、W3Schools、CSS-Tricks等,获取最新的技术资讯和教程。通过参与社区和利用资源,可以不断学习和提升自己的技能。

七、持续学习

前端技术发展迅速,持续学习保持技术的更新与提升非常重要。可以通过阅读技术书籍、观看视频教程、参加技术会议和培训等方式,不断更新和拓展自己的知识体系。同时,可以关注前端技术的最新发展趋势和动态,如新版本的浏览器、新的框架和工具等,保持与时俱进的技术水平。通过持续学习,可以不断提升自己的技术能力和竞争力。

通过系统学习HTML、CSS、JavaScript,掌握框架与库,熟悉工具与环境,进行项目实战,参与社区与资源分享,持续学习和更新知识,Web前端开发工程师可以不断提升自己的技能和水平,成为一名优秀的前端开发工程师。

相关问答FAQs:

Web前端开发工程师应该从哪里开始学习?

学习Web前端开发的第一步是了解基本的前端技术和工具。前端开发主要涉及HTML、CSS和JavaScript。这三者是构建网页的基础,掌握它们能够让你创建静态网页。HTML用于定义网页的结构,CSS用于样式和布局,而JavaScript则为网页添加交互功能。可以通过在线课程、书籍和视频教程来学习这些基本概念。许多平台如Codecademy、Coursera和Udemy都提供相关课程。此外,参与开源项目和实践开发可以帮助你将理论知识转化为实际技能。

在学习的过程中,建议同时学习一些现代前端框架和库,例如React、Vue和Angular。这些框架能够帮助你更高效地构建复杂的用户界面。通过实践项目来巩固所学知识,比如创建个人网站或小型Web应用,可以进一步提升你的技能。

在学习Web前端开发时应该避免哪些常见错误?

新手在学习Web前端开发时,常常会犯一些错误。一个主要的问题是对基础知识的不重视。许多初学者希望直接跳过基本概念,直接进入框架和库的学习。这样做会导致在面对复杂问题时缺乏解决能力。因此,扎实的基础是非常重要的。

另一个常见的错误是过于依赖在线教程和视频,而不进行实际编码实践。理论学习固然重要,但只有通过实际操作,才能真正理解和掌握前端开发的技能。建议在学习每一个新概念后,尝试自己动手写代码,解决实际问题。

此外,很多初学者容易忽视代码的可维护性和可读性。编写清晰、结构良好的代码不仅有助于团队合作,也能让你在未来的项目中更加高效。因此,在编写代码时,应始终遵循良好的编程规范和最佳实践。

如何保持在Web前端开发领域的竞争力?

Web前端开发是一个快速发展的领域,因此保持竞争力非常重要。首先,持续学习是关键。随着技术的不断更新,新的框架、工具和最佳实践层出不穷。定期参加在线课程、阅读技术博客和关注行业动态,将帮助你保持对前端技术的敏感度。

加入前端开发社区也是一个提升自己的好方法。参与论坛、技术讨论组或社交媒体平台,分享经验和学习资料,可以让你接触到不同的观点和技术。此外,参加技术会议和Meetup活动,不仅可以学习到新知识,还能结识同行,拓展人脉。

最后,构建一个个人项目组合(Portfolio)也是展示你技能的重要方式。无论是个人网站、开源项目还是工作中完成的项目,能够展示你的能力和创造力的作品将使你在求职时更具竞争力。通过不断更新和完善你的项目组合,能够有效地展示你的成长和进步。

原创文章,作者:jihu002,如若转载,请注明出处:https://devops.gitlab.cn/archives/219499

(0)
jihu002jihu002
上一篇 1天前
下一篇 1天前

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

GitLab下载安装
联系站长
联系站长
分享本页
返回顶部